Babette s'en va-t-en guerre, Christian-Jaque, Brigitte Bardot, 1960.
Synopsis : En 1941, une jeune provinciale française est à Londres où le lieutenant Gérard de Crécy la fait engager comme femme de ménage au Quartier Général de la France libre. Le major Fitzpatrick, officier de renseignement britannique, remarque son étrange ressemblance avec Hilda, l'ex-maîtresse du responsable allemand du débarquement en Angleterre, le général von Arenberg. Après un entraînement intensif, elle est parachutée en France avec Gérard afin d'enlever le général. Après de multiples aventures, elle se fait engager par Schulz, chef de la Gestapo, pour surveiller Arenber.

MADAME SANS-GENE (1961) - NAPOLEON IN MOVIES (Part 9/10)
Adapted from the famous French Play by Victorien Sardou, this Napoleonic era epic comedy follows Sophia Loren as a laundress who is bestowed honors by Napoleon after she and her Sergeant lover (Robert Hossein) performed heroic deeds and finds themselves thrown in the Napoleon imperial court.
A fantastic grand scale fun movie where La Loren exudes sexy joy and charisma
One of the most beautifully filmed movies with incredible lights and settings that is a must watch to enjoy both Cinema and the Napoleon battles

Josephine visits Aachen Cathedral in 1804
“Berdolet presented Joséphine with the Talisman of Charlemagne featuring an emerald and a sapphire surrounded by some four dozen gems and pearls. The hair relic of the Virgin Mary behind the jewels had been transferred to the Agnus Dei reliquary and replaced with a cross relic. But Joséphine politely declined a grimy bone said to be from the emperor’s [Charlemagne] right arm, telling Berdolet that she already had ‘the support of an arm just as strong as Charlemagne’s.’”
— Susan Jaques, The Caesar of Paris: Napoleon Bonaparte, Rome, and the Artistic Obsession that Shaped an Empire, pp. 128
